The images in this gallery are authentic copies from the masters at The National Gallery of Art in Washington, DC. Each piece is authenticated by the NGA as a copy from the original and painted in oil. Most are on a linen surface. Some are on gallery stretchers and do not require framing as they are painted around the sides of the canvas. Careful research and study was done to learn the process and use of color during the time period the original painting was created. These one-of-a-kind works of art are available for sale.
